What companies run services between Venice, Italy and Erbach (Rheingau), Germany?

You can take a train from Venezia S. Lucia to Erbach(Rheingau) via Milano Centrale and Frankfurt(Main)Hbf in around 12h 20m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Venezia, Tronchetto to Frankfurt Airport twice daily. Tickets cost €60–110 and the journey takes 12h 45m.
